- Invalid structure: removal of structure &1 from BO &2 failed ?The SAP error message DMC_MD_XSD009 indicates that there was an issue with the removal of a structure from a Business Object (BO) in the Data Migration Cockpit (DMC). This error typically arises during data migration processes when the system encounters inconsistencies or issues with the data structure.
Cause:
- Inconsistent Data: The structure you are trying to remove may still have dependencies or references in the data model, which prevents its removal.
- Data Integrity Issues: There may be existing records that rely on the structure you are attempting to delete, leading to integrity violations.
- Configuration Errors: The Business Object or the structure may not be correctly configured, leading to issues during the removal process.
- Authorization Issues: The user executing the operation may not have the necessary permissions to modify the Business Object or its structures.
Solution:
- Check Dependencies: Before attempting to remove a structure, ensure that there are no existing records or dependencies that rely on it. You may need to delete or modify these records first.
- Review Configuration: Verify the configuration of the Business Object and the structure. Ensure that they are set up correctly and that there are no inconsistencies.
- Data Cleanup: If there are records that reference the structure, consider cleaning up the data or migrating it to a different structure before attempting the removal.
- Authorization Check: Ensure that the user has the necessary authorizations to perform the operation. If not, consult with your system administrator to obtain the required permissions.
- Consult Documentation: Refer to SAP documentation or notes related to the Data Migration Cockpit for any specific guidelines or troubleshooting steps related to this error.
